Complete breakout of SMB, GSSAPI, and NTLM
- Looser coupling between these analyzers. - New ntlm.log (still pretty early) - Improved string handling for NTLM (convert UTF16 to UTF8) - SMB2 analyzer now supports GSSAPI. - Improved abstraction of DCE_RPC operations (still not finished) - Lots of whitespace cleanup.
